The Gaza War Cost the Zionists $38 Billion.
According to the Palestinian Information Center, according to a report by the economic newspaper Kalkalist, the Israeli war against Gaza has cost a total of 142 billion shekels (Israeli currency) by the end of 2024, equivalent to about $38.5 billion.
The details published in the report show that the net cost of the war (excluding US aid) was 121.3 billion shekels, equivalent to $33 billion, of which about 96.4 billion shekels ($26.2 billion) were spent on military affairs and 24.9 billion shekels ($6.7 billion) were spent on civilian affairs.
The highest monthly cost of the war was recorded in December 2023, during which 17.2 billion shekels ($4.7 billion) were spent in just one month.
According to official data, the war has increased the budget deficit by 1.4 percent of GDP in 2023 and 4.8 percent in 2024, leading to a total budget deficit of 106.2 billion shekels ($28.8 billion) by the end of 2024.
The war has also caused a significant reduction in tax revenues, a figure that remains difficult to accurately estimate.
